Support teams are under constant pressure to handle growing ticket volumes while maintaining fast response times and high service quality. As organizations expand their digital operations, service desks often become overwhelmed with requests ranging from routine password resets to critical security incidents. This challenge has made AI powered ticket triage one of the most valuable innovations in modern service management.
Traditional ticket handling often relies on manual classification, prioritization, and assignment. These processes consume valuable time and can lead to delays, human errors, and inconsistent service delivery. AI powered ticket triage transforms this workflow by using artificial intelligence to analyze, categorize, prioritize, and route tickets automatically.
For cybersecurity professionals, online security teams, service desk managers, MSPs, and business leaders, AI powered ticket triage offers a powerful way to improve efficiency, reduce operational costs, and deliver better user experiences.
AI powered ticket triage uses artificial intelligence, machine learning, and natural language processing to automate the initial handling of support tickets.

Cybersecurity incidents often require immediate attention.
Delayed response can significantly increase organizational risk.
AI powered ticket triage improves security operations by helping teams identify and escalate critical threats quickly.
Security-related tickets receive immediate attention.
Critical incidents reach security teams faster.
AI distinguishes between routine requests and serious threats.
Organizations gain better insight into recurring security issues.
For security operations centers and IT teams, AI powered ticket triage becomes an important component of incident response readiness.
Several advanced technologies make intelligent ticket handling possible.
AI analyzes large volumes of historical ticket data.
Machine learning models continuously improve routing accuracy.
NLP enables systems to understand user requests written in everyday language.
Predictive models identify patterns and forecast ticket outcomes.
Automation tools execute workflows without manual intervention.
Together, these technologies create a highly efficient support environment.
